Warrior Run was not able to break out of their rough patch on Tuesday as the team picked up their 21st straight defeat dating back to last season. They took a blow against the Southern Columbia Area Tigers, falling 53-25. Sadly, that's the second time they've come up short against the Defenders this season, as they also lost their prior matchup 54-23 back in January.
Warrior Run's loss dropped their record down to 0-20. As for Southern Columbia Area, with the victory, they broke their five-game losing streak and moved their record to 10-10.
Coincidentally, both will both be playing Shikellamy the next time they take the court. Warrior Run will head out to face Shikellamy at 1:30 p.m. on Saturday, while Southern Columbia Area will host them at 7:15 p.m. on Monday.
